The Role
We are looking for a Sr. Android Engineer to help us build awesome Android apps. This person will work on platforms that impact millions of users for the Aura Mobile application and other security products within our suite.
Responsibilities
- You will collaborate with Engineering leaders, Product, Design, and Server teams to design, develop and create Android applications with rapid release cycle prototypes.
- You will also have a relentless focus on quality code and improve our code base through continuous refactoring.
- The ideal candidate is a self-starter, detail and quality oriented, as well as passionate about having a huge impact in providing privacy and security to millions of our users.
Qualifications
- Android Developer with 5+ years of development experience using Android SDK
- Java (5+ years)
- Good knowledge of Android OS architecture
- Proficiency with Android API: activities, fragments, content providers, services, etc.
- Familiarity with RxJava, Retrofit, Dagger, and MVP design
- Good understanding of Android UI (layouts, etc.)
- Experience with Web services (experience integrating with web services i.e. RESTful APIs/JSON/XML for Android apps)
- Comfortable with unit testing and rapid release cycles
- Proficient in object-oriented analysis, design and implementation
- Applied knowledge of software engineering and best practices such as testing, documentation and code reviews
- Ability to work on tasks with minimum supervision
- A collaborative approach, being open to help team member
- Work with third-party dependencies and debug dependency conflicts
- A track record of published applications to the Google Play Store
- BS/MS CS or related engineering degree
